Output eac7ca824de18d8e5a0da982b8383b1707e7408faf2c57836949322f935c94c6:1

value
26911026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a76c7f37544e3913f14c295983b5a61cdf48419 OP_EQUAL
address
MMytb2PPCcLXBqF6uLth4Pu6T4mZbmy7Wt
transaction
eac7ca824de18d8e5a0da982b8383b1707e7408faf2c57836949322f935c94c6
spent
true